August 21, 2019Circulation Arrhythmia and Electrophysiology227 citations

Catheter Ablation Versus Medical Therapy for Atrial Fibrillation

Structured PICO

Does catheter ablation reduce all-cause mortality compared to medical therapy in patients with atrial fibrillation?

P
Population
Patients with atrial fibrillation (AF)
I
Intervention
Catheter ablation (CA)
C
Comparator
Medical therapy
O
Outcome
All-cause mortalityhard clinical

Catheter ablation provides mortality and hospitalization benefits over medical therapy in patients with atrial fibrillation, particularly those with concurrent heart failure with reduced ejection fraction.

Abstract

CA is associated with all-cause mortality benefit, that is driven by patients with AF and heart failure with reduced ejection fraction. CA reduces cardiovascular hospitalizations and recurrences of atrial arrhythmia for patients with AF. Younger patients and men appear to derive more benefit from CA.
